What Singapore’s Climate Is Doing to Your Home
Consider what is actually happening behind the scenes. When you notice faint grey marks appearing on your walls after a stretch of rainy days, that is mold. It begins in places you cannot see: in the tiny pores of wall paint, between tiles, behind furniture pushed against exterior walls. It grows because Singapore’s humidity provides exactly the conditions it needs. And once it establishes itself, wiping the surface does not eliminate the colony living beneath.
The same applies to condensation building on air conditioning vents, dampness settling into mattress borders, and the persistent mustiness that clings to curtains no matter how often you wash them. These are not cleaning failures. They are climate conditions that surface-level approaches were never designed to address.
Then there are the inhabitants you share your home with, ones whose presence you feel more than see. Dust mites thrive in warm, humid environments. They live in your bedding, your sofas, your carpets, anywhere that human skin cells accumulate and moisture levels remain elevated. For many Singapore households, the persistent sneezing, the itchy skin, the nasal congestion that comes and goes without explanation — these are not random occurrences. They are often a direct response to conditions inside the home.
Humidity in Singapore also seeps into wooden cabinetry, causing warping over time. It settles into the grout between bathroom tiles, breaking down sealants and encouraging bacterial growth. It compromises the adhesives that hold mirrors and fixtures in place. It dulls the finish on hardwood floors.
None of this happens dramatically. It happens slowly, invisibly, until one day you notice your three-year-old sofa no longer looks new, or your freshly painted wall has developed a patch of discoloration, or the air in your living room feels thicker than it should.
When humidity levels remain consistently high, when ventilation is insufficient, when mold colonies establish themselves in hidden spaces, the air inside a home can contain higher concentrations of allergens, spores, and irritants than the air outside. For children, for elderly family members, for anyone with respiratory sensitivities, this is the reason they wake up congested on days that seem no different from any other. Indoor air quality connects the condition of the home directly to the wellbeing of the people inside it.

Choosing a Housekeeping Provider in Singapore
If you are evaluating housekeeping services for your home, here are the questions that matter most, beyond pricing and availability.
- Does the provider understand Singapore’s climate specifically? A service that applies the same methodology used in other markets may not be accounting for humidity, mold risk, or tropical allergen management.
- Is the service consistent or ad-hoc? Regular, scheduled care builds over time and can address environmental patterns. One-off bookings treat symptoms but cannot establish the ongoing protection a home needs.
- Are the staff trained to notice what is happening in the environment? Effective housekeeping goes beyond task lists. Housekeepers should be attentive to moisture accumulation, ventilation concerns, and the condition of surfaces that indicate deeper issues.
- Does the provider communicate clearly and reliably? Reliability matters enormously when someone is entering your personal space. Scheduling consistency, responsive communication, and clear service standards reflect how seriously the provider takes its commitment.
- Is the service designed around your household’s rhythm? Whether you are a busy professional, a family with children and pets, a tenant preparing for inspection, or a homeowner maintaining a property, your home has distinct needs that deserve a tailored approach.
